c-semantics.c (add_scope_stmt): Abort if the end SCOPE_STMT doesn't match the begin SCOPE_STMT in partialness.

        * c-semantics.c (add_scope_stmt): Abort if the end SCOPE_STMT
        doesn't match the begin SCOPE_STMT in partialness.

cp/
        * semantics.c (do_pushlevel): Call pushlevel after adding the
        SCOPE_STMT.
        (do_poplevel): Call poplevel before adding the SCOPE_STMT.
        * parse.y (function_body): Go back to using compstmt.
        * decl.c (pushdecl): Skip another level to get to the parms level.

        * call.c (build_new_method_call): Use is_dummy_object to determine
        whether or not to evaluate the object parameter to a static member
        function.
